Hello all,

I bought 6 WD Reds and I have been stress testing the drives. None had any issues with bad blocks but upon further messing around when I attempt to expand with 3 of the drives I get a message:
Code:
No Disks With Enough Capacity Available For Raid Expansion

Now if I take the 3 "bad" drives, create an array, I'm able to expand the array with the 3 "good" drives.

Coincidentally, I had a drive fail in another array and I tried to use one of the "bad" drives as a spare to rebuild it but it didn't do anything. It started rebuilding after I added a "good" drive as a hot spare.


http://imgur.com/a/wRXZw/
Screenshots from RAID. The first 3 are the "bad" ones and the last 3 are the "good" ones.

The RAID controller is an Areca 1680 and I'm trying to create/expand a RAID6.
